WebThe Patent System and Innovation Performance in Ethiopia By Wondwossen Belete, Ethiopian Intellectual Property Office Introduction Ethiopia is in the process of formulating a national science, technology and innovation policy Creation of a development oriented intellectual property system a core element of the policy A national System of Innovation … WebHave you ever wondered why Ethiopian tourist promotion slogan reads ^13 months of Sunshine? _ well thats because the Ethiopian calendar has 13 months a year, with 30 days each month except the 13th known as Zthe Pagumen which means additional in Greek. As of this year, 2002, the Ethiopian calendar is eight years behind and indicates it is 1994.

WebMany respondents valued these areas for their potential for tourism rev- enues and resource use in times of need (e.g., dry-season pasture and sources of water in drought). Residents that expressed value for protected areas tended to be older, better edu- cated, have large families, and to have previously received some tangible benefit from the reserve.
